About 20% of people have elevated Lp(a), yet guidelines diverge sharply on how to manage it, and youth recommendations barely exist, a review (Curr Opin Endocrinol Diabetes Obes 2021)
Original title: Expert position statements: comparison of recommendations for the care of adults and youth with elevated lipoprotein(a)
This review by Wilson, Koschinsky and Moriarty compares recent recommendations for managing adults and youth with elevated Lp(a), present in approximately 20% of the general population and a well-established causal, independent risk factor for cardiovascular disease, including myocardial infarction, stroke and aortic valve stenosis. Several guidelines and position statements now exist for identifying, treating and following up adults with elevated Lp(a), but recommendations for youth remain limited despite growing interest in early screening and health behaviour strategies. The authors note emerging data from the coronavirus pandemic suggesting adults with elevated Lp(a) may face particularly high cardiovascular complication risk, and that while Lp(a)-specific lowering therapies remain in development, statins, despite not lowering Lp(a) itself, still improve outcomes in primary and secondary prevention. The authors call for more harmonised, comprehensive Lp(a) guidelines covering both adults and youth.
Original abstract
Purpose Of Review: Summarize recent recommendations on clinical management of adults and youth with elevated lipoprotein(a) [Lp(a)] who are at-risk of or affected by cardiovascular disease (CVD).
Recent Findings: There is ample evidence to support elevated Lp(a) levels, present in approximately 20% of the general population, as a causal, independent risk factor for CVD and its role as a significant risk enhancer. Several guidelines and position statements have been published to assist in the identification, treatment and follow-up of adults with elevated levels of Lp(a). There is growing interest in Lp(a) screening and strategies to improve health behaviors starting in youth, although published recommendations for this population are limited. In addition to the well established increased risk of myocardial infarction, stroke and valvular aortic stenosis, data from the coronavirus pandemic suggest adults with elevated Lp(a) may have a particularly high-risk of cardiovascular complications. Lp(a)-specific-lowering therapies are currently in development. Despite their inability to lower Lp(a), use of statins have been shown to improve outcomes in primary and secondary prevention.
Summary: Considerable differences exist amongst published guidelines for adults on the use of Lp(a) in clinical practice, and recommendations for youth are limited. With increasing knowledge of Lp(a)'s role in CVD, including recent observations of COVID-19-related risk of cardiovascular complications, more harmonized and comprehensive guidelines for Lp(a) in clinical practice are required. This will facilitate clinical decision-making and help define best practices for identification and management of elevated Lp(a) in adults and youth.
